We researched into the film, 'Die Hard,' directed by John McTiernan and starring Bruce Willis and Alan Rickman. The characters that agree with Vladimir Propp's theory are:-The hero - John McClane
-The Villain - Hans Gruber
-Donor - The villain who McClane defeats and loots
-Helper - Argyle
-Princess - Holly McClane
-Father - The police
-Dispatcher - Christmas
-False hero - Hans Gruber, the journalist on TV and Dwayne (he is shown to be an idiot).
There are 31 functions to this film:
Preparation - Getting ready and setting up the story:
1. John McClane travels from New York to LA
2. He goes to a private party and a rule is imposed on the hero - the lifts and windows are cut out
3. The rule is broken by McClane and Hans Gruber as they use the lifts
4. Hans tries to find something out, he tries to find out who and where Joseph Takagi is
5. Hans finds out where Takagi is
6. Hans tries to get the code off Takagi for the vault, and Hans ties to deceive the victim with questions
7. Takagi doesn't know the code, so tells Hans he'll have to kill him
Complications - Things start to get complicated and mess up how things are meant to happen:
8. Hans kills Takagi
9. McClane runs away after hearing the villain's plan
10. McClane pulls the fire alarm to call the fire brigade
Transference - Going from one place to another (movement):
11. Hero goes to the top of the building/leaves the room he was in
12. He gets attacked by villain
13. Kills the villain and gets the objects from him such as a radio and a gun
14. He uses the radio and let's the villains know he has the objects
15. McClane goes to the roof to call the police
Struggle - There is conflict:
16. Hero gets shot at by the villains but gets cornered, so goes through the vent
17. He cuts his feet
18. Villain's are shot and McClane escapes
19. Hans gets back the detonators for the building and McClane escapes
Return - The hero returns:
20. McClane returns to the bathroom (safe haven)
21. Villains catch McClane on the top floor
22. McClane hangs the villain
23. Hero shoots gun on the roof to evacuate the guests, but police think he's a terrorist
24. The reporter on the news exposes McClane's family
25. McClane has to escape from the roof
26. McClane escapes and rescues his wife
Recognition - Hero is recognised, the villain is defeated and there is a happy ending (usually):
27. McClane is recognised by Al
28. The false hero/villain is exposed
29. McClane is given a coat
30. Final villain is killed and the news reporter is punched
31. McClane is reunited with his family and drives off in a limo
